Reprieve came the way of kidnapped staffers of Bowen University, Iwo, Osun State on Thursday when they were released by their abductors
It is recalled that the victims, comprising of two males and female staffers were abducted around Idominasi community of Obokun local government area of Osun State on Monday.
They were said to be traveling from Ilesa to Osogbo when their vehicle was ambushed and the occupants were kidnapped by four men wielding guns and other dangerous weapons.

In a statement issued by the Police Public Relations Officer (PPRO) of Osun Police Command, Mrs. Folasade Odoro shortly after the incident, she explained that “the vehicle conveying two males and a female was reportedly blocked and the occupants were abducted by about four men welding gunĀ wearing military and vigilante uniforms.”
“Recovered at the scene was an army cap reasonably suspected to belong to one of the suspects. Meanwhile, dragnet has been spread out with a view to safely rescue the victims and bring the culprits to book.”
However, the PPRO confirmed the release of the abducted workers to.journalists in Osogbo.

Odoro hinted that “the victims had been released, our men worked tirelessly to secure their release.Ā Give me more time to get details of what happened, I will get back.”
But, calls put through cell phone of the Registrar of Bowen University, Iwo, Dr. Kayode Ogunleye, were not answered as of the time of filing this report.
